American Repertory Theater to Stage TRANS SCRIPTS, PART I: THE WOMEN
by BWW
News Desk
- Jan 19, 2017
The American Repertory Theater (A.R.T.) at Harvard University, under the leadership of Artistic Director Diane Paulus and Executive Director Diane Quinn, will present Trans Scripts, Part I: The Women, written by Paul Lucas and directed by Jo Bonney. Performances begin today, January 19 and run through Sunday, February 5 at the Loeb Drama Center, 64 Brattle St, Cambridge.

JENNA ESPOSITO Launches 2017 New York Cabaret's Greatest Hits Season at Metropolitan Room With Award-Nominated CONNIE FRANCIS Tribute Show, 2/13
by Stephen Hanks
- Jan 14, 2017
Singer/Actress Jenna Esposito made her New York nightclub debut in 2004, and has been delighting audiences across the country ever since. Esposito is perhaps best known for her tribute to iconic pop singer Connie Francis-Jenna Esposito Sings Connie Francis-a show that has been a smash hit among audiences and critics since it debuted in 2009. Connie Francis herself has praised Jenna's work, raving, 'I've known and loved Jenna for years and love the way she sings. I'm so grateful for the love and respect she shows to the catalog of songs that has been so good to me through the years.' Now Esposito will be reprising her critically acclaimed show to launch the 2017 season of the BroadwayWorld.com Award-Nominated series NEW YORK CABARET'S GREATEST HITS at the Metropolitan Room on February 13 at 7 pm.
